Safety Circuit Requirements for PILZ Safety Relays
1. When the emergency stop is released, the machine cannot suddenly restart
2. In case of a malfunction in the safety circuit of the machine, the power supply of the machine can be stopped
3. When the safety circuit malfunctions, the machine cannot be restarted
How can safety circuits be achieved if inputs such as safety switches and light curtains that confirm safety cannot achieve the above functions? Is a dual circuit sufficient?
A: Relying solely on dualization is not enough.
Dualization is necessary, but in addition, there are several conditions to consider, such as mutual inspection of the doubled circuit, confirmation that all safety circuits have been disconnected once, and if necessary, it can be started by the operator. From another perspective, when there is a possibility of grounding caused by a short circuit in the input switch wiring or damage to the wire sheath, it is necessary to prevent sudden machine start-up caused by this.
In fact, in order to facilitate the composition of safety circuits, products that combine safety relays with other components and form basic emergency stop circuits and safety circuits into circuit modules are called safety relay modules.
Reasons for using PILZ safety relay
Why can't ordinary relays be used for safety related applications?
Ordinary relays use the mechanical action of coils and metal contacts to switch loads. Metal contacts may melt due to repeated operation. Once this situation occurs, the machine will continue to operate after the operator presses the E-STOP button. At this point, place the user in a hazardous environment. Many European safety standards, the United States, and national standards prohibit the use of simple relays and contactors on machines that pose a danger. In 1987, Pilz invented the DI compact safety relay PNOZ. Subsequently, derivative products such as emergency stops, safety doors, dual hand controls, and light barriers were invented and continuously expanded. Nowadays, Pilz's PNOZ series has become synonymous with safety relays, providing a range of high-quality safety relays such as PNOZ sigma, PNOZ X, PNOZmulti, etc. that meet different application needs.
Configurable safety relays (configurable safety controllers, programmable safety relays)
When there are more than 3 or 4 safety functions, using multiple safety relays will have a higher cost and cumbersome wiring. Faced with the application of multiple safety functions, Pilz has specifically developed a configurable safety relay PNOZmulti.
PNOZmulti is a multifunctional, freely configurable modular security system. Unlike other PNOZ safety relays, the safety circuit of PNOZmulti can be easily generated on a PC using a graphical configuration tool. PNOZmulti is equivalent to a small safety PLC that meets the PL highest safety level of EN 13849-1. Up to 14 different security functions can be used within the basic unit. Expandable input/output module and communication module.
